Despite it being a woman's model - it's still quite desirable in blue dial and rose gold.

I don't think any boutique would be responsive to get a cold call from you (an unknown potentially even from a different country) asking about what will look like a one-off purchase to them.

For better or worse, AP does want to establish a longer term relationship with its clients. Part of that is making a visit, trying on some watches and talking about what you're looking for.

Without that I'm afraid youll get pretty much the same answer you got every single time .

AP is planning to open a number of new outlets (mostly/all AP houses) in Europe in the next years. I think (but may be hallucinating) this includes one in the Netherlands. Unless this is time-critical and/or the only AP you envision acquiring, I'd try to find out more about their plans, and then try to establish a relationship with the closest, and maybe even local, outlet.

AP has 215 different models and the average boutique sells 500 watches a year, so the likelihood that a boutique has a relatively low production model like the RG 34mm in stock (and unallocated) at any given time is small. Multiply with APs desire to get to know their clients, and obtaining the watch through cold-calls would be very fortuitous.
